Biomes

Large groups of ecosystems sharing the same climate and having similar plant and animal communities.

Climate

The average annual temperature and amount of rainfall in an area, influenced by factors like latitude, elevation, land masses, and ocean currents.

Tropical Rainforest

Biome with large amounts of rain, home to over half of Earth's land species, found in regions around the Equator.

Savanna

Tropical grassland with a long dry season and short wet season, inhabited by large herbivores like giraffes and zebras.

Temperate Grassland

Biome excellent for agriculture, found in central North America, South Africa, and Argentina.

Taiga (Boreal Forest)

Coniferous forest with long, cold winters, located in Canada around 50°-60° N latitude, home to animals like moose, wolves, and bears.

Tundra

Biome with little rainfall, frozen water in soil (permafrost), and smaller plants and animals like foxes, owls, and caribou.

Polar Regions

Extremely cold areas bordering the tundra, with the Arctic Ocean in the north (covered by ice) and Antarctica in the south, inhabited by animals like polar bears, arctic foxes, penguins, whales, and seals.
